If two-factor codes never arrive, your issue might stem from network issues, outdated system security, or device settings. Unstable mobile signals, carrier restrictions, or incorrect time setups can delay or block messages. Sometimes, security flaws or outdated app versions also interfere, increasing the risk of missing codes. Checking contact details, permissions, and network status often helps, but understanding the underlying causes can reveal more solutions that might fix the problem for good.
Key Takeaways
- Network issues or poor reception can delay or block the delivery of two-factor authentication messages.
- Incorrect device settings, such as time misalignment or permission restrictions, prevent code reception.
- Carrier restrictions or spam filters may block or divert authentication messages.
- Outdated security measures or system glitches can cause message delivery failures.
- Inaccurate contact details or outdated contact information hinder message receipt.

Network problems are another common culprit. If your mobile network is unstable or you’re in an area with poor reception, your text messages or email alerts for codes can get delayed or lost. Sometimes, carriers block certain messages due to spam filters or technical restrictions, which can prevent the codes from reaching you. Additionally, incorrect time settings on your device can cause synchronization issues, preventing received codes from being accepted. These network and device-related issues highlight how critical a stable connection is for seamless two-factor authentication. When the process is unreliable, it not only impacts your user experience but can also create security vulnerabilities, as users might seek alternative, less secure methods to access their accounts. Being aware of your network status and troubleshooting connectivity issues can significantly improve the reliability of the authentication process.

Can I Request to Resend the Two-Factor Code?
Yes, you can request to resend the two-factor code. Often, authentication apps or SMS reliability issues cause delays. To resolve this, check your network connection or switch to an authentication app if SMS isn’t reliable. Most services have a “resend code” option—just tap it. If you still don’t receive it, consider verifying your contact info or trying again after some time.

How Long Do Two-Factor Codes Typically Last?
Two-factor codes usually last about 5 to 10 minutes, making them very time-sensitive. The code expiration time varies depending on the service, so you should use it promptly. If you don’t enter the code within the validity window, it becomes invalid, requiring a new one. To avoid issues, always check the expiration time and act quickly, as delays can prevent successful authentication.
Are There Alternatives if Codes Don’t Arrive?
If your two-factor codes don’t arrive, don’t worry. You can use backup options like recovery codes or email verification to maintain your security protocols. Many platforms provide alternative user authentication methods, such as authenticator apps or biometric verification. Always verify your contact information is up-to-date, and consider setting up multiple authentication methods to avoid disruptions. These alternatives help keep your account secure even when codes fail to arrive.
